Health Clearances
A responsible breeder will conduct health screenings on both parents prior breeding to minimize the risk of inheritable diseases. Ask the breeder if results of the screenings have been certified. A reputable breeder must have their dogs' pedigrees readily available.
German Shepherds are at risk of hereditary health issues, such as elbow dysplasia and hip dysplasia as well as degenerative myelopathy. Responsible breeders will test their pups for these and other ailments offer nutrition and exercise and offer continuous guidance and support to ensure their health.
Hemolytic anemia, a condition in which red blood cells break down more quickly than they should, is common in German Shepherds as well as other large breed dogs. This condition can cause weakness dizziness, fatigue as well as lightheadedness and lack of energy. It can also cause nausea, fever, and Reinrassiger Deutscher SchäFerhund Welpe vomiting. Fortunately hemolytic anemia can be treated by prescription medications as well as other treatments.
German Shepherds may also be affected by cancer, another common inherited disease. It can manifest as tumors on the skin or in internal organs and is usually treated through radiation, chemotherapy or surgery.
german shepherd kaufen Shepherds may also be affected by an inflammatory bowel disease. It's a condition that can cause diarrhea and abdominal pain, as well as weight loss and other symptoms.
Degenerative joint disease is another common musculoskeletal issue that can affect German Shepherds. It's a result of the wear and SchäFerhund Kaufen öSterreich tear on joints over time, which can lead to discomfort or even arthritis. Losing weight, exercising restrictions and joint protection supplements are the most common treatment options for joint issues.
Degenerative myelopathy, a progressive spinal disease caused by a genetic disorder, can affect any breed of dog including German Shepherds. The disease is more prevalent in white dogs and may be caused by two "carriers" that are crossed. The condition is still under investigation, and therefore the DM is not required to obtain a CHIC through OFA.
Socialization
German Shepherds have a protective nature, which is something that owners love. If the GSD hasn't been properly socialized with people and other dogs, their natural instincts may become problematic. It can lead to excessive protection, which could include barking and biting. The best way to avoid this issue is to make sure that the puppy has had ample exposure to various people, dogs, environments and schäferhund kaufen öSterreich experiences during the critical period of socialization that lasts from 3 to 14 weeks.
Most reputable breeders make sure that their puppies are exposed to a variety of people, animals and experiences early on. This is crucial to a well-adjusted adult dog. This is especially important for working breeds and herding breeds that are naturally wary of strangers.
Exposing your puppy to new situations should be done slowly beginning in less stressful environments and building up to more crowded environments. Positive reinforcement, treats and play are the best ways to motivate the puppy to engage with new experiences.
It is also a good idea to expose your dog to a variety of environments, sounds and smells. This will allow your dog to feel comfortable in a variety of settings, and also help them to be more calm and SchäFerhund Kaufen öSterreich relaxed.
As a responsible dog parent You must be prepared to spend lots of time in exposing your German Shepherd pup to new experiences as it grows. This will allow them to develop into happy, schäferhund Welpe kaufen well-adjusted and comfortable people.
